摘要: Three complexes [AMP][Ni(mnt)2]·CH3CN (1, AMP=1-(9-anthrylmethyl)pyridinium), [DPI]2[Ni(mnt)2]I (2, DPI=diphenyliodonium) and [DD][Ni(mnt)2]2·2H2O (3, DD=dimethylenediamine) have been prepared and characterized by elemental analyses and IR spectroscopy. X-ray diffraction studies show that three complexes crystallize in the same triclinic space group P1, and anionic accumulations are formed in a column shape. The results show that different counter-cations could induce versatile anionic stacks. The structures of three complexes exhibit rich hydrogen bonding interactions. In addition, UV-VIS properties of them are also investigated.
